Latest Patents

One of his latest patents is titled "Process for preparation of indolizine based derivatives as potential phosphodiesterase 3 (PDE3) inhibitors." This invention provides compounds of general formula 1 that are useful as potential PDE3 inhibitory agents. The derivatives can be employed as therapeutics in both human and veterinary medicine, targeting diseases such as heart failure, dilated cardiomyopathy, platelet inhibitors, cancer, and obstructive pulmonary diseases.

Another notable patent is "Pyridopyrimidine based derivatives as potential phosphodiesterase 3 (PDE3) inhibitors and a process for the preparation thereof." Similar to his previous work, this invention also provides compounds of formula 1 as potential PDE3 inhibitory agents. These derivatives can be utilized in the treatment and prophylaxis of various medical conditions, including heart failure and cancer.
